Neyveli Lignite Corporation Limited (NLC) is one of the largest lignite-based power producers in India, and one of the largest single customers of Coal India Limited, the nation’s largest coal mining company. In addition to this, NLC supplies lignite to other power companies within the state and outside of it, accounting for the bulk of Tamil Nadu’s total thermal energy output.

Pay Range

Graduate Executive Trainees (GET) who join NLCIL will receive one year of training. The GETs will be trained at this time. A monthly basic pay of INR.50,000/-, Dearness Allowance (currently 29.4% of basic pay), and Common Allowance (currently 35% of basic pay) would be paid. The pay scale and CTC will be as follows.

Graduate Executive Trainee – Grade E-2 – INR.50,000 – 1,60,000

After successfully completing the course, the students will be placed in the E-3 Grade, with a basic wage of INR. 60,000/- per month and a pay scale of INR. 60,000-1,80,000. In addition, they will be awarded Performance Related Pay on a yearly basis and will be eligible for Superannuation (30% of Basic Pay + DA).
